#e1778f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e1778f is composed of 88.2% red, 46.7%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 47.1% magenta, 36.4%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 346.4 degrees, a saturation of 63.9% and a lightness of 67.5%. #e1778f color hex could be obtained by blending #ffeeff with #c3001f.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

Shades and Tints of #e1778f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090203 is the darkest color, while #fdf8f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e1778f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aeaaab is the less saturated color, while #fb5d81 is the most saturated one.
